WARRANT
Cornwall, ON – An 18-year-old Cornwall man was arrested on March 5, 2025, on the strength of an outstanding warrant. It is alleged on Feb. 27, 2025, the man was scheduled to attend court and failed to do so. A warrant was issued for his arrest. On March 5, 2025, the man attended the Cornwall Police Service to address the matter. The warrant was executed and he was scheduled to appear in court on April 10, 2025.
FAIL TO COMPLY, SHOPLIFTING, POSSESSION BREAK-IN INSTRUMENTS, POSSESSION OF SCHEDULE I SUBSTANCE FOR PURPOSE OF TRAFFICKING
Cornwall, ON – A 38-year-old Cornwall man was arrested on March 5, 2025, and charged with the following:
- Two counts of fail to comply with probation order
- Theft under $5,000 – shoplifting
- Possession of break-in instruments
- Possession of Schedule I substance for the purpose of trafficking – methamphetamine
It is alleged on March 5, 2025, the man was bound by a probation order with the relevant conditions to keep the peace and be of good behaviour and to not possess or consume any unlawful drugs or substances. It is also alleged on this date, the man attended a Vincent Massey Drive business, selected merchandise and left the store without making an attempt to pay for the items. Police were contacted and an investigation ensued. The man was located and the investigation also revealed he was in possession of a lock picking kit as well as methamphetamine and a digital scale. He was taken into custody, charged accordingly and later released to appear in court on April 8, 2025.
FAIL TO COMPLY
Cornwall, ON – A 37-year-old Cornwall woman was arrested on March 5, 2025, and charged with three counts of fail to comply with probation order and two counts of fail to comply with release order. It is alleged on March 5, 2025, the woman was bound by a probation order with the relevant conditions to keep the peace and be of good behaviour, to not contact her ex-boyfriend and to not be within 100 metres of him. It is also alleged on this date, the woman was bound by a release order with the relevant conditions to not contact her ex-boyfriend and to not be within 100 metres of him. On March 5, 2025, police responded to a disturb the peace complaint and an investigation ensued. The woman was located and the investigation revealed she was in communication and contact with her ex-boyfriend. She was taken into custody, charged accordingly and held for a bail hearing.
